Transaction 1d51582c8051ae64b53c2c027c35d1496e405051ea53e49b3311f64be8117caa
1 Input
1 Output
-
1d51582c8051ae64b53c2c027c35d1496e405051ea53e49b3311f64be8117caa:0
- value
- 296615
- script pubkey
- OP_0 OP_PUSHBYTES_20 745c9f2479b690443c8c2688cd654f5e75d6a00c
- address
- bc1qw3wf7frek6gyg0yvy6yv6e20te6adgqv02rxcl